  • One of the key benefits of using anatase titanium dioxide in paints is its high opacity and hiding power. This pigment is able to cover imperfections on the substrate and create a smooth and even finish. Additionally, anatase titanium dioxide is resistant to weathering, UV radiation, and chemicals, which ensures the durability and longevity of the paint film.

This method involves bombarding the sample with X-rays and measuring the resulting fluorescence spectrum. XRF offers fast analysis times and requires minimal sample preparation, making it suitable for on-site testing. However, its accuracy may be affected by matrix effects and interference from other elements.

  • Anatase TiO2 with 99.6% purity exhibits excellent physical and chemical properties. It has a high refractive index, which contributes to its high opacity and excellent hiding power. The material is also highly resistant to UV light, making it suitable for use in outdoor applications. Chemically, it is stable under normal conditions and does not react with most acids or bases.
